About Timon Vassiliou

Timon Vassiliou is a scholar working on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and Ophthalmology, having authored 22 papers that have together received 402 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Anesthesia and Pain Management (10 papers),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(6 papers) and Intraocular Surgery and Lenses (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ine (41 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(98 citations) and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(21 citations). Timon Vassiliou has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, United States and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Hinnerk Wulf, C. Putzke, Michael Schnabel, Gert Kaluza, Thorsten Steinfeldt, Susanne Rinné, Wilhelm Nimphius, Günter Schlichthörl, Jürgen Graf and Hans‐Helge Müller. Their work appears in journals such as Pain, Anesthesiology and American Journal of Physiology-Cell Physiology.
